Transaction 5100b515ee201168672d463e3476f3b60adf3a28033431397167cca322c2c09a

1 Input
2 Outputs
  • 5100b515ee201168672d463e3476f3b60adf3a28033431397167cca322c2c09a:0
  • value  742593
    address  16y1yCB79dthnBY2zvUp36kv7G25yXFDLJ
  • 5100b515ee201168672d463e3476f3b60adf3a28033431397167cca322c2c09a:1
  • value  30568616
    address  1HjPQk9sFTqFmfAGQLmG7aeihFmQdnG9XJ